Campanula medium, common name canterbury bells, is an annual or biennial flowering plant of the genus campanula, belonging to the family campanulaceae. In floriography, it represents gratitude, or faith and constancy. Campanula alliarifolia seeds (ivory bells). This is the beautiful, biennial, old fashioned heirloom canterbury bells. it lacks the saucer of the more familiar cup and saucer. introduced to england from spain in 1596, it is a popular cottage garden flower. The canterbury bells (campanula medium), originates in southern europe.

It is naturalized in most of european countries and in north america and it is widely cultivated for its beautiful flowers. Blooms are 2 double bells that look like cups and saucers and come in shades of white, pink, blue, and lavender.
